Output 3d631a92b57473efe85280986f4e9d32685f396a22992f18c00f9431d288a479:0

value
5048952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7dc34853fda79d94307ccf426c58caaf6adfb44 OP_EQUALVERIFY OP_CHECKSIG
address
1KDmGJDh6fkNVw7Ldaex8dvHWcNX2JNQiR
transaction
3d631a92b57473efe85280986f4e9d32685f396a22992f18c00f9431d288a479
confirmations
449897
spent
true